The Root Children is one of my all time favorite stories. I am currently working on giving them knitted flowers. Can’t wait to share them in the spring.

Free Old Father Sliffslaff-Slibberslak pattern here!

To make a Root Child, you’ll need: 12mm wooden bead for the head, scrap yarn (in pretty colors), a set of dpns and one free evening
